The warmouth ( Lepomis gulosus) is a freshwater fish of the sunfish family ( Centrarchidae) that is found throughout the eastern United States. Other local names include molly, redeye, goggle-eye, red-eyed bream, and strawberry perch. Description Adult warmouth from Kickapoo State Park, Illinois.

GOGGLE EYE BIO SCIENTIFIC NAME: Selar crumenophthalmus AKA: bigeye scad, goggle eyed blue runner, gogs, cojinua, mas bango, akule, chicharro, charrito ojón, purse-eye scad, coulirou PROMINENT FEATURES: The Goggle Eye or bigeye scad is abundant in warm seas throughout the world.

The rock bass ( Ambloplites rupestris ), also known as the rock perch, goggle-eye, red eye, and black perch, is a freshwater fish native to east-central North America.

A store in Kuwait has reportedly been shut down after it was discovered that its owners were sticking googly eyes on fish in an attempt to make them appear fresher. Googly-eyed fishes The barreleye had been known for 50 years, but no one knew about its amazing adaptations until Monterey Bay Aquarium Research Institute (MBARI) researchers videotaped the animal alive, in its native habitat, using a robotic subersible. Barreleye photo provided by MBARI.

Goggle-eye (Rock Bass) and Warmouth. Thicker-bodied than most other sunfish with large mouth and very large eyes. Spiny dorsal fin with 12 spines broadly connected to soft dorsal fin. Anal fin with 6 spines. Color variable but generally dark brown to bronze above, often blotched on sides. Distinct pattern of dark spots arranged in parallel.

The bigeye scad ( Selar crumenophthalmus) is a species of oceanic fish found in tropical regions around the globe. [2] Other common names include purse-eyed scad, goggle-eyed scad, akule, chicharro, charrito ojón, jacks, matang baka, mushimas and coulirou. [2] The bigeye scad is fished commercially, both for human consumption and for bait.

Appearance. Also known as goggle-eye. Eye very large, diameter greater than snout length. No detached dorsal and anal finlets. Two fleshy tabs on inside of rear edge of gill chamber. Scutes present only on rear part of lateral line. Similar Species: Round scad, D. punctatus (has detached dorsal and anal finlets) Size: Up to 24 inches.
